A aerobull Unregistered / Unconfirmed GUEST, unregistred user! 2006-09-29 #1 某一个form已经不是当前活动窗口,有什么办法让他的caption的颜色还是与活动时一样?
轻 轻舞肥羊 Unregistered / Unconfirmed GUEST, unregistred user! 2006-09-29 #5 TForm1 = class(TForm) private procedure WMNCACTIVATE(var Message : TMessage);message WM_NCACTIVATE; end; procedure TForm1.WMNCACTIVATE(var Message: TMessage); begin message.wParam := 1; end;
TForm1 = class(TForm) private procedure WMNCACTIVATE(var Message : TMessage);message WM_NCACTIVATE; end; procedure TForm1.WMNCACTIVATE(var Message: TMessage); begin message.wParam := 1; end;
H hs-kill Unregistered / Unconfirmed GUEST, unregistred user! 2006-09-29 #6 type TForm1 = class(TForm) private { Private declarations } procedure WMNCACTIVE(var msg: TMessage); message WM_NCACTIVATE; public { Public declarations } end; procedure TForm1.WMNCACTIVE(var msg: TMessage); begin msg.WParam:=integer(true); inherited; end;
type TForm1 = class(TForm) private { Private declarations } procedure WMNCACTIVE(var msg: TMessage); message WM_NCACTIVATE; public { Public declarations } end; procedure TForm1.WMNCACTIVE(var msg: TMessage); begin msg.WParam:=integer(true); inherited; end;
X xiammy Unregistered / Unconfirmed GUEST, unregistred user! 2006-09-29 #8 象TBX,TMS自己本身都实现了一些泊靠窗体,都是自己实现的Caption部分。 你也只要去掉Form原来的Caption部分,自己定义一个高度的Caption就可以了。